A discrepancy between processing speed and verbal ability in gifted youth is genetically and diagnostically associated with autism

BackgroundHigh cognitive ability is an almost universally positive prognostic indicator in the context of neurodevelopmental, neuropsychiatric, and neurodegenerative conditions. However, "twice-exceptional" individuals, those who demonstrate exceptionally high cognitive ability (gifted) and exhibit profound behavioral and mental health challenges, are a striking exception to this rule. MethodsWe digitized the clinical records of N=1,074 clients from a US-based specialty clinic serving gifted students. This included a broad array of diagnostic, cognitive, achievement, and behavioral data, including self, teacher, and parent reported items. We conducted both hypothesis-driven and unsupervised learning analyses to 1) identify characteristics whose association with full-scale IQ (FSIQ) was dependent on autism diagnosis and 2) identify cognitive archetypes associated with autism diagnosis and related behaviors. We tested the generalization of our findings using data from the SPARK (N=17,634) and ABCD studies (N=10,602). ResultsAutistic individuals with IQ >= 120 were nearly 15 times more likely to enter adulthood undiagnosed compared to lower-IQ (IQ < 70) counterparts. Self-reported sense of inadequacy was most strongly associated with increasing FSIQ specifically among autistic clients (beta=0.3, 95% CI:[0.15,0.45], p=7.1x10-5). Similarly, self, parent, and teacher reports of anxiety increased with FSIQ (all p<0.05) in autistic individuals, in striking opposition to the ameliorating effect of FSIQ seen in non-autistic individuals. We uncovered a pattern of decreased processing speed (PS) coupled with very high verbal comprehension (VC), a PS/VC discrepancy, that was associated with autism, inattention, and internalizing problems. Similar cognitive-behavioral links were also observed in the ABCD study. Finally, we found a significant association between the PS/VC discrepancy and polygenic risk for autism in the ABCD sample (t=2.9, p=0.004). ConclusionsOur results suggest that autistic individuals with exceptional ability are underserved and suffer disproportionately from high anxiety and low self-worth. In addition, elevated IQ with a significant PS/VC discrepancy appears to be a clinically and genetically meaningful biotype linked to autism.
